WebAug 21, 2024 · Go to Settings > Devices > Printer & scanners > select your printer > Open queue. Next, select the document, then select Document > Cancel. To cancel all print jobs, select Printer > Cancel All Documents. How do I change my default printer in Windows 10? WebFeb 27, 2024 · You can clear the print queue using this the Windows GUI. WebOct 25, 2024 · In the Run window, type services.msc and hit Enter. Scroll down to Print Spooler. Right-click Print Spooler and select Stop. Navigate to C:\Windows\System32\spool\PRINTERS and delete all files in the folder. (Do NOT delete the folder itself.) In the Services window, right-click Print Spooler and select Start. Go back to …
